public void attributeRemoved(HttpSessionBindingEvent event) { if ("edu.intenet2.middleware.grouper.ui.GrouperSession".equals(event .getName())) { GrouperSession s = (GrouperSession) event.getValue(); if (s != null){ try { s.stop(); }catch(Exception e){} } } }
LOG.debug("Result " + result); grouperSession.stop();
public static void main(String[] args) throws Exception{ Subject gs = SubjectFinder.findById("GrouperSystem", true); GrouperSession s = GrouperSession.start(gs); Group g = GroupFinder.findByName(s,"qsuob:all", true); Set members=g.getMembers(); PrintWriter writer = new PrintWriter(System.out); ResourceBundle bundle = ResourceBundle.getBundle("resources/grouper/media"); MembershipExporter export= new MembershipExporter(); export.export("Minimal",members,writer); writer.flush(); s.stop(); }
sysSession.stop();
sysSession.stop();